Brief Life History of Mary

When Mary Delawder was born about 1782, in Shenandoah, Virginia, United States, her father, Lawrence Phillip Delawder, was 43 and her mother, Barbara Catherine Miller, was 45. She married Elijah Evans about 1805, in Ohio, United States. They were the parents of at least 1 son. She died in 1837, in Virginia, United States, at the age of 56.

1800 · Movement to Washington D.C.

While the growth of the new nation was exponential, the United States didn’t have permanent location to house the Government. The First capital was temporary in New York City but by the second term of George Washington the Capital moved to Philadelphia for the following 10 years. Ultimately during the Presidency of John Adams, the Capital found a permanent home in the District of Columbia.
